NOTE

Only the quantities selected when ordering the device can be selected for
an output quantity.

Examples:

>asel td tdf<cr>
Ch1 Td lo : -40.00 'C ?
Ch1 Td hi : 100.00 'C ?
Ch2 Tdf lo : -40.00 'C ?
Ch2 Tdf hi : 60.00 'C ?

>asel x td<cr>
Ch1 x lo : 0.00 g/kg ?
Ch1 x hi : 160.00 g/kg ?
Ch2 Td lo : -40.00 'C ?
Ch2 Td hi : 60.00 'C ?
>

ASCL Scale Analog Outputs

Syntax: ASCL<cr>

Example:

>ascl<cr>
Ch1 Td lo : -40.00 'C ?
Ch1 Td hi : 100.00 'C ?
Ch2 x lo : 0.00 g/kg ?
Ch2 x hi : 500.00 g/kg ?
